WebbThe Legislative Branch (Parliament) Parliament is Canada’s legislature, the federal institution with the power to make laws, to raise taxes, and to authorize government spending. The Parliament of Canada is “bicameral”, meaning it has two chambers: the Senate and the House of Commons. It was in this role … The parliamentary oversight function is one of the cornerstones of democracy. It holds the Executive accountable for its actions and ensures that it implements policies in accordance with the laws and budget passed by Parliament. WebbThe meaning of LEGISLATION is the action of legislating; specifically : the exercise of the power and function of making rules (such as laws) that have the force of authority by … WebbThe legislature plays an important role in shaping the annual budget and in providing budgetary oversight. When fiscal policies and medium-term budgetary objectives are debated in parliament and annual budget laws are adopted by the legislature, budget strategies and policies are “owned” by the elected representatives.

WebbThe primary role of the municipal council is that of political oversight of the municipality’s functions, programmes and the management of the administration. All of the powers of local government are vested in the municipal council.
